Let's break down the typical IKEA offering. The glass is usually soda-lime, moderately thick, and likely tempered for added strength—a process companies like EUR-ASIA COOKWARE have down to a science for their high-volume exports. But tempering can introduce minor dimensional inconsistencies. The cork lid is often a composite, not pure cork, pressed into a metal or plastic band. This is where the first functional compromise happens. Pure cork provides a better natural seal against moisture and air but is more expensive and variable. The composite version is consistent and cheap but may not seal as effectively long-term, especially if the inner rim of the glass jar isn't perfectly smooth.
I recall a batch from a different supplier years ago where the jars looked flawless, but the lids were a nightmare. The cork discs were cut too thick and hadn't been properly stabilized. When forced into the band, they bulged. When you tried to close the jar, you'd either get no seal or have to jam it so hard you risked cracking the glass. It was a classic case of the lid being treated as an afterthought. The IKEA version usually avoids this by using a thinner, pre-compressed cork liner, but that brings its own trade-off in longevity and resealability after the first few uses.
The sealing surface—that tiny, almost invisible ridge on the jar's neck that the cork presses against—is everything. If it's too sharp, it cuts into the cork. Too rounded, and the seal is weak. I've seen production lines where a slight wear in the molding equipment led to a whole day's output of jars that wouldn't hold a vacuum for dry goods. It's these microscopic tolerances that separate a good jar from a great one. Manufacturers focused on technical products, like those producing tempered glass lid for cookware, often have tighter control here because the performance requirement is non-negotiable.
Everyone loves the idea of cork—natural, renewable, tactile. In practice, it's a sourcing headache. Its quality varies wildly based on origin, harvest cycle, and processing. A high-quality cork lid for a storage jar needs to be washed and boiled to remove tannins and dust, then dried to a specific moisture content. Skip steps, and you risk imparting a musty odor to your coffee beans or flour. IKEA's scale likely demands a processed cork composite for consistency, which is smart from a supply chain view but strips away some of cork's inherent functional benefits.
There's also the expansion/contraction issue. Cork is hygroscopic. In a humid kitchen, it can swell, making the lid frustratingly tight. In dry, air-conditioned air, it can shrink, breaking the seal. This is why for truly long-term, airtight storage (think decades for dried legumes), a glass jar with a rubber gasket and metal clamp is superior. The IKEA glass jar with cork lid fits perfectly in the active pantry category—goods you rotate within months. It's not for archival storage, no matter what the Instagram photos suggest.

In a home kitchen, these jars shine for certain uses and disappoint in others. They're excellent for storing pasta, rice, or lentils—items with low moisture content that you use regularly. The cork allows just enough breathing to prevent condensation if there are minor temperature swings, which is actually a benefit for these goods. Where they fail, in my experience, is with very fine powders (like flour or powdered sugar) or strong spices. The cork isn't a perfect barrier, and aromas can migrate, and fine powders can attract moisture through microscopic gaps.
Another practical note: washing. You must let the cork lid dry completely away from the jar before reassembling. Trapping moisture between the cork and glass rim is a recipe for mold. I've seen it happen. Some users solve this by applying a thin coat of food-grade mineral oil to the cork, which helps stabilize it and repel water. It's a good hack, but not one the average buyer knows.
The jar's versatility is its selling point, but that's also its limitation. It's a generalist. I wouldn't use it for storing homemade pickles (the acid can degrade the cork and metal band), for vacuum-sealing coffee beans, or for liquid oils. Recognizing what a product is not designed for is as important as knowing what it is good for.
